More about environmental scientist courses in Adelaide

If you’re considering a career as an Environmental Scientist, exploring the various Environmental Scientist courses in Adelaide can set you on the right path. With a range of advanced courses available, including the Bachelor of Environmental Science and the Master of Environmental Science, you’ll gain the knowledge and skills needed to tackle pressing environmental issues in your local area and beyond. Notably, reputable institutions such as UniSA and Flinders University are among the training providers offering these empowering courses.

The field of environmental science also opens doors to various job opportunities that you might find appealing. Graduates can pursue roles such as an Environmental Consultant or an Environmental Advisor, contributing significantly to sustainability projects in Adelaide. Each role leverages the advanced knowledge gained through courses like the Graduate Diploma in Environmental Science and the Master of Environmental Management, ensuring you are well-prepared for the real-world challenges ahead.

As you embark on this educational journey, you may also explore related Environment and Sustainability courses that complement your primary studies. These courses can further enhance your qualifications, preparing you for specific roles such as a Sustainability Manager or a Sustainability Officer. With a focus on both academic and practical skills, the Graduate Certificate in Planetary Health can be particularly beneficial for those aiming to make a global impact from their base in Adelaide.
